  • PRP and PRF use your body's own biology to support skin renewal and hair health.

    Because the treatment uses your own platelets and growth factors, it's one of the most natural approaches we offer and the results develop gradually and authentically over time.

  • PDO Mono Threads work beneath the surface to support skin firmness and texture, stimulating your skin's own collagen over time. The result is a gradual improvement in skin structure, without altering the way your face moves or looks.

  • Bio-stimulators work differently to traditional fillers, rather than adding volume, they stimulate your skin's own collagen production over time. The result is a gradual, natural improvement in skin quality and structure that builds across several months.

How long does wrinkle reduction last?

Results vary between individuals and depend on a number of factors including the area treated, muscle activity, and metabolism.

Your practitioner will discuss realistic expectations during your consultation, however most of our patients return every 3-4 months.
